Output 72caf9cd2d1bd9a6f488a735dcd62ebd843881f78c98d787c60dcacd9405091d:5

value
2089546
script pubkey
OP_HASH160 OP_PUSHBYTES_20 c321a46d1585409b29b86498570a6c3c72023189 OP_EQUAL
address
3KUmzTWkzfWWLj6wejkEbPsEQfgduDZVTo
transaction
72caf9cd2d1bd9a6f488a735dcd62ebd843881f78c98d787c60dcacd9405091d
spent
true